Understanding CVE-2023-2670
CVE-2023-2670 is a critical vulnerability found in SourceCodester's Lost and Found Information System version 1.0. It allows for improper access controls and can be exploited remotely.
What is CVE-2023-2670?
The vulnerability in SourceCodester's Lost and Found Information System version 1.0 affects an unknown part of the file admin/?page=user/manage_user, enabling unauthorized access. This issue has been classified as critical due to the potential security risks it poses.

Vulnerability Description
The vulnerability in SourceCodester's Lost and Found Information System version 1.0 arises from improper access controls, allowing attackers to manipulate the admin/?page=user/manage_user file and gain unauthorized access.
Affected Systems and Versions
SourceCodester's Lost and Found Information System version 1.0 is confirmed to be impacted by this vulnerability.
Exploitation Mechanism
Attackers can exploit this vulnerability remotely by manipulating the identified file, potentially gaining unauthorized access to the system.
